Transaction

3e8e7dfffcde9c7a0c089dd513f45e5128499d2f2220ea5491a67e91f7b4e2d8
106,854 confirmations
Timestamp
1709904583
Block833,743
Fee18,624 sats
Fee rate31.7 sats/vB
view on mempool.space

Inputs & Outputs